Lancaster 1 Posted September 4 #2 Share Posted September 4 A small reprieve, a bit of shut eye to relax the chaotic schedule the pair had held the last few days. Albeit Lancaster's not nearly as demanding as Mari's yet even still it wasn't easy. Something as simple as a nap and a conversation not racked by tension and drama had worked wonders in thinning out stress that had been building for the man for some time. Fingers intertwined with Mari's, finding the warmth welcoming as they'd travel through the sights and sounds of multiple floors. Organic yet long, the red head couldn't help but draw that normally this would have been frustrating but Mari made it bearable at worst, but he was actually enjoying the trek. Like a hiking trip, all this walking was actually inviting. Probably simply because he got to spend time with his beloved, and admire her expertise. It was clear that she'd done this for a long while, how she seemed to have her bearings and knew where they were time and time again. The 10th floor, Yomi. An absent and empty settlement that had always been ignored. It had little of worth, and even less to pilfer. "Might be worth the investment, don't think I could stomach all this travel alone. With you, is enjoyable." He'd mutter plainly, his expression twisting into a smile. "As to the effects of the floor, I am aware. Is where recruits for the guild are sent to 'break them in'." Lancaster would provide a snapshot to his own knowledge of the floor with added emphasis, although he'd hardly visited it personally. This was Genma's domain. "Is best we keep our time here to a minimum, it will loosen screws we didn't know we had." Looking toward Mari, watching her wiggle her finger in a small circle toward her noggin. "Yet, you've outgrown it." Pecking her forehead, he'd round a strand of dangling hair around her right ear. "Isn't too bad, a tour sounds good. Like to find some of that brilliance of yours mi amore. If you're willing to share?" It was all the motivation Mari needed to do just that, "Then I shall make it happen. You should see the col I've amassed lately!" Mari said to him as she'd turn to offer him a kiss on the underside of his chin. Her eyes fluttered close as she took a moment to breathe deep, enjoying the mix of earthy and chemical scents that came from him. The scent of gasoline and acetone a little stronger than usual. Mari couldn't help but laugh into her kiss before pulling away. "I can tell you've been working, Vincent." She softly said, hints of amusement and delight in her tone. "Is good you're keeping busy whilst I'm..." She'd turn her cerulean gaze over the wasteland before her. "stockpiling supplies." In truth, Mari had been incredibly concerned, having left him more or less alone the last few days before their wedding. Waking up before the sun rose - and going to bed long after it had set. This trip was still tiring, and yet - it didn't seem to exhaust Mari. She was finally spending time with Lancaster - time where they weren't fighting for their lives. Where they weren't on edge, always looking over their shoulders. It was a relief. It cemented their relationship. It actually felt like she could just enjoy Lancaster for all that he is. "I can't wait for you to show me what you've done." Mari thought aloud to herself as she pulled him along, closer toward the Stygian river. Mari would listen to Lancaster and with a small nod, she'd point to a location, a little beyond the horizon - "Somewhere near there, no?" Mari asked. "I've seen many a player, both orange and green alike make the trip to that particular set of caverns. Most think they are alone but..." Mari tapped her temple. "Night Vision. I see what others do not. I am perhaps more familiar with this floor than your previous company, even." Mari would squeeze his hand tighter. "Sometimes, I would want to follow to see just what they were doing, but curiosity like that is a fools errand. One time A broad shouldered fellow saw me nearby, but we each left each other well enough alone - Not my business. I too thought about bringing people here, leave them to see how long it'd take. But...I'm not one to experiment with peoples minds, anymore." Mari said with finality. The two walked hand in hand toward the river, every so often Mari would pull Lancaster into a different direction - pointing out the cave she met Atan, her 'associate' who helped her with her workshop, making a point to tell him about the bacteria in the stagnant pond there. nagleria fowleri - And how she wanted to experiment with it, but held back. Concerned what her brother would think. Mari told him about the echo flowers around the void - and even explained in detail how she had thrown herself in it at one point. The effects it had on her. How even to this day, every so often she'd hear the faintest of whispers. Of all the players in all of Aincrad, Mari was probably one of the few who had managed to build up a small tolerance to the floor. Not completely immune to its effects, but she'd last longer than most. "After this quest, we can stop by my store, if you like?" Mari offered. "It sits on the outskirts of Yomi. But - ah..." Mari paused, her nose wrinkling, the acrid smell of iron and the hiss of acid in the air. "We're close." Edited September 4 by Mari Link to post Share on other sites
